Transaction 3fddfeeeb489e76d932cc4ce3252fde2f9594408e2745560a9402c6811aa41b8

1 Input
2 Outputs
  • 3fddfeeeb489e76d932cc4ce3252fde2f9594408e2745560a9402c6811aa41b8:0
  • value  2503954
    address  38wwbUJk4kHp33SpF2D9wLL1StHLeV3bgY
  • 3fddfeeeb489e76d932cc4ce3252fde2f9594408e2745560a9402c6811aa41b8:1
  • value  444515
    address  14BwjEJ5qxbnuuvL3MgbwX9pDgff9HyZVf